Transaction 5786026cf6ef176fbc22b8a5943ecdde364668a9f1f084f3e659dc490be3e063

2 Input
2 Outputs
  • 5786026cf6ef176fbc22b8a5943ecdde364668a9f1f084f3e659dc490be3e063:0
  • value  59260
    address  mu1oX5L2b5XEvmnyYB4UH8KyFtWeTDykby
  • 5786026cf6ef176fbc22b8a5943ecdde364668a9f1f084f3e659dc490be3e063:1
  • value  70740
    address  mytu3FGw8cTzGTBTQZoVcZ2CZaYpRdk2YA